Yahoo settles with Icahn to avert shareholder fight over fate of Internet company
(AP:SAN FRANCISCO) Yahoo Inc. averted a showdown with rabble-rousing investor Carl Icahn on Monday by giving him three seats on its board of directors in a truce that still leaves the door open for a possible sale to Microsoft Corp.

Belkin RockStar and TuneStudio(TM) Receive International Design Excellence Awards (IDEA) Presented by IDSA and ...
Belkin International, Inc., has been recognized for its innovative and exciting product designs with two IDEA awards, by cosponsors Industrial Designers Society of America (IDSA) and BusinessWeek. Belkin was given a Silver award for RockStar, a multi-headphone splitter, and a Bronze award for TuneStudio, a 4-channel mixer for iPod, in the Computer Equipment category.

Providence to pay fine for HIPAA violations
Providence Health & Services will pay a $100,000 fine as part of a settlement agreement with federal regulators tied to the health system's loss of electronic backup media and laptop computers containing individually identifiable health information in 2005 and 2006.

Efforts to bring glitzy new graphics to Linux are fueling an old conflict: Does proprietary software belong in open-source Linux? The issue involves software modules called drivers, which plug into the kernel at the heart of the open-source operating system.
